Business Summary

Microchip Technology Incorporated is a leading provider of smart, connected, and secure embedded control solutions. The company develops, manufactures, and sells a broad portfolio of microcontrollers, microprocessors, field-programmable gate arrays (FPGAs), analog, and memory products. Microchip's Total System Solution (TSS) approach combines hardware, software, and services to help customers reduce costs, increase revenue, and manage risks. The company's products are used in a wide variety of applications across key end markets including automotive, aerospace and defense, communications, consumer appliances, data centers, and industrial. Microchip competes on the basis of technical innovation, performance, and cost-effectiveness.

Products and Services

Microchip offers a broad range of embedded control solutions:

  • Mixed-signal Microcontrollers: General-purpose microcontrollers with integrated analog and mixed-signal functionality.
  • Analog Products: Power management, linear, mixed-signal, high voltage, thermal management, discrete diodes, MOSFETS, RF, drivers, safety, security, timing, USB, ethernet, wireless and other interface products.
  • Other Products: FPGA products, royalties from technology licenses, intellectual property sales, engineering services, memory products, timing systems, and manufacturing services.

Key Business Segments

Microchip operates through two reportable segments:

  • Semiconductor Products: Includes the design, development, manufacture, and sale of microcontrollers, microprocessors, FPGAs, analog, and memory products.
  • Technology Licensing: Includes the licensing of SuperFlash and other technologies.

The semiconductor products segment accounted for the majority of the company's revenue in fiscal 2024. The company does not allocate operating expenses, interest income, interest expense, other income or expense, or provision for or benefit from income taxes to these segments.

Business Strategy

Microchip's strategy focuses on providing cost-effective embedded control solutions with advantages in size, performance, power usage, and ease of development. Key strategic initiatives include:

  • Expanding production capacity in the U.S.
  • Transitioning products to more advanced process technologies.
  • Maintaining a high level of manufacturing control through ownership of manufacturing resources.
  • Leveraging a broad product portfolio to offer Total System Solutions.
  • Focusing on innovation and new product development.

The company aims to capitalize on disruptive growth trends such as 5G, data centers, sustainability, IoT, and electric vehicles. Microchip is also investing in silicon carbide (SiC) production capacity.
